TER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review

1,223 of the 8,128 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Teradyne (TER)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$42.8B — up 46% from $29.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 294 funds opened new TER positions and 88 closed out — a net gain of 206 holders — while 419 added to existing stakes and 394 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Lone Pine Capital, opening a new position worth an estimated $522M. The largest seller was Allspring Global Investments, cutting an estimated $612M.
